The Open Layers module has enough functionality to allow users to add and remove locations from a map. I would suggest you start out by reading the Open Layers documentation which is under "Resources" in the right hand column of the Open Layers project page -> http://drupal.org/project/openlayers

Note, you will need to be comfortable with the concepts of node types, CCK, Views, and Drupal Permissions to get this working. Thanks, yes, OL can do it.

The problem is primarily the user interface, even with OL Geocoder. Asking people to enter "street, city and state" yields surprsingly incomprehensible (to the geocoder) results.

A "submit" button like Google Maps "Search Maps" could help, and exists with Google Maps Tools module. http://drupal.org/project/gmaps

OL Geocoder does have a drag and point option.

The difficulty is not the capability of the mapping modules to add and remove locations, it is the user interface and user understanding.
